Host–Virus Interaction: How Host Cells Defend against Influenza A Virus Infection
Influenza A viruses (IAVs) are highly contagious pathogens infecting human and numerous animals. The viruses cause millions of infection cases and thousands of deaths every year, thus making IAVs a continual threat to global health.
